PUPILS across the US marked the 19th anniversary of the Columbine school massacre yesterday by staging mass walkouts in protest at gun violence.
The national walkout was organised following the Parkland school shooting in Florida in February, in which 17 people were killed.
Demonstrations were held in every state in the US with students making calls to their senator’s offices demanding reforms to gun laws.
